我们提供消息推送系统招投标所需全套资料,包括消息推送系统介绍PPT、消息推送系统产品解决方案、
消息推送系统产品技术参数,以及对应的标书参考文件,详请联系客服。
大家好,今天我们来聊聊如何在视频应用中实现一个既安全又高效的统一消息平台。首先,我们要明白什么是统一消息平台。简单来说,它就是一个可以接收、处理和发送各种类型消息的系统,比如文本、图片、音频和视频。
接下来我们说说等保,也就是信息安全等级保护。这是中国的一项强制性标准,用于评估和规范信息系统的安全水平。对于视频应用来说,等保的要求尤为重要,因为视频数据量大且敏感。
现在我们来看看如何在视频应用中实现一个符合等保要求的统一消息平台。首先,我们需要对用户的身份进行验证,确保只有授权用户才能访问系统。这里我们可以使用JWT(JSON Web Tokens)来进行身份验证。
// Python 示例代码
import jwt
def generate_token(user_id):
token = jwt.encode({'user_id': user_id}, 'secret', algorithm='HS256')
return token
def verify_token(token):
try:
payload = jwt.decode(token, 'secret', algorithms=['HS256'])
return True
except jwt.ExpiredSignatureError:
return False
其次,为了确保数据传输的安全,我们需要使用HTTPS协议。这可以通过配置Web服务器来实现。比如,如果你使用的是Nginx,可以在配置文件中添加以下内容:
# Nginx 配置示例
server {
listen 443 ssl;
server_name yourdomain.com;
ssl_certificate /path/to/certificate.crt;
ssl_certificate_key /path/to/private.key;
location / {
proxy_pass http://localhost:8080;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
}
}
最后,为了保护视频数据不被非法访问,我们应该使用加密技术。例如,我们可以使用AES(Advanced Encryption Standard)算法来加密视频文件。
以上就是如何在视频应用中实现一个符合等保要求的统一消息平台。希望这些示例代码和建议能够帮助到你!
;